Now for those of you who are asking themselves "Pete Rouse who?", Rouse is a Democrat who spent a four years working in Juneau for then Lt. Governor Terry Miller.  Since then Rouse has worked for Senator Tom Daschle for a number of years and now works as President Obama's Senior Advisor.  There is also a lot of talk recently about Rouse taking Rahm Emanuel's Chief of Staff position once Rahm leaves to run for Mayor of Chicago.

Palin's particular bitch "du jour" with Rouse may be that she doubts he is really eligible to be a registered voter in Alaska after all of these years, and blames the local media for not ferreting out the truth.  However it appears that Rouse is, or at least was as of January 21, 2009, still registered to vote in Alaska as reported by the very "Alaska media" that Palin swears has fallen down on the job.

Of course Sister Sarah has had a bee in her bonnet about Pete Rouse for a number of years now, even "suggesting" in her book that HE stole Obama's "CHANGE" theme from her.  She also believes that he is part of the shadowy conspiracy of Obama operatives that inspired the filing of ethics charges against her and is behind the Alaska bloggers.
